Overview
WSP is looking for a Senior Remediation Engineer for our Rancho Cordova, CA office. The candidate will have experience in consulting, selling, managing, designing and implementing environmental multi-media remediation programs for clients in the Industrial, Government, Energy, Oil & Gas and Transportation sectors. The role supports expanding WSP’s environmental consulting business in California and the West. WSP’s California offices provide services in environmental assessment and remediation, water/wastewater engineering, water resources, environmental compliance, geotechnical design, stormwater infrastructure design, materials testing, and decision analysis. Responsibilities
Perform business development within the Oil & Gas and Industrial/Commercial sectors for environmental remediation, engineering and related services Provide oversight, mentorship, and direct the efforts of staff- and project-level engineers and scientists Assist in the preparation of technical reports and proposals Interact with Local Business Leader, Office Manager, Sector Lead, and other senior-level employees Manage multiple projects, ensuring deliverables, schedules, and budgets are achieved Travel to project sites as needed to execute project goals and support business development Meet sales, revenue, and delivery goals Qualifications
Bachelor’s Degree in Civil, Chemical, Environmental or related engineering discipline 5-7 years of related environmental remediation and sales experience Strong work ethic; self-starter, team-oriented with excellent verbal and written communication skills Ability to mentor and direct engineers and technicians Experience with CERCLA, RCRA, DTSC, Water Board and other CalEPA programs Consulting experience with petroleum-contamination cleanups in soil and groundwater (including LNAPL) and/or chlorinated solvent contamination remediation Experience in soil gas and vapor intrusion issues Developing and managing complex environmental remediation projects Overseeing remediation construction and operation and maintenance of environmental project work Must pass physical, background check and have a valid driver’s license with satisfactory driving record Must be able to pass HAZWOPER physical and wear a tight-fitting respirator / Fit for Duty Exam Must successfully complete and pass WSP’s Motor Vehicle screening Subject to client-mandated drug/alcohol testing policy Preferred Qualifications
Master’s Degree is preferred California Civil Professional Engineer (PE) registration 40-Hour OSHA HAZWOPER training (29 CFR 1910.120) preferred Basic First Aid and Adult CPR training desired Compensation & Benefits
Compensation: Expected Salary: $93,700 - $136,620. WSP USA provides a comprehensive benefits package including medical, dental, vision, disability, life insurance, retirement savings, paid time off, and additional family and personal leaves as applicable. About WSP
